Remote Disaster Engineering focuses on planning and responding to emergencies and disasters, often involving remote assessments and coordination. In contrast, Remote Civil Engineering centers on designing and managing infrastructure projects, typically in a more office-based or site-specific setting. Both roles require engineering credentials but serve different industry needs and work environments.

ABOUT TELEGENT
Telegent is a next-generation mobile communications platform redefining how businesses and brands connect people through wireless technology. We provide a software-first, API-driven mobile Platform-as-a-Service (mPaaS) that combines intelligent voice, messaging, data, and unified communications into a single, flexible solution.
At Telegent, we move fast, think creatively, and build technology that makes mobile communications simpler, more powerful, and more adaptive for the future.
ABOUT THE ROLE
The Staff SIP Engineer is responsible for designing, implementing, and supporting carrier-grade SIP-based voice services across Telegent's mobile and unified communications platforms. This role works closely with network engineering, product, operations, and carrier partners to ensure high availability, call quality, scalability, and regulatory compliance across our voice infrastructure.
This is a hands-on role requiring deep SIP expertise, strong troubleshooting skills, and real-world carrier interconnection experience.
